Domine

Domine is an Italian heavy metal band formed in 1983. The power metal band from Florence, who began releasing demo tapes in 1986, got some attention with their first album, ''Champion Eternal'', released in 1997. Domine went on to release four more albums, touring Europe and playing at many festivals. They have been linked to heroic fantasy and sword and sorcery writers like Michael Moorcock and Robert E. Howard for their lyrics related to the Elric of Melniboné and Conan the Barbarian novels.
==Champion Eternal==

''Champion Eternal'' was the starting point of a new life for the band, after many years in the underground scene. The band had been in existence for some time when the debut album was released, by Italian label Dragonheart, having previously recorded four demo tapes (from 1986 to 1994) getting reviews and interviews in a lot of fanzines and magazines around the world. However, the line-up of the band changed just before the CD was released. The new line-up of the group was Enrico Paoli on guitars, Riccardo Paoli on bass (the only ones left of the original line-up), Mimmo Palmiotta on drums (previously with Masterstroke and Death SS) and Morby on vocals (ex-Sabotage, one of the very first metal bands in Italy).
The band has been compared by magazines and fanzines to Manowar, Queensrÿche, Warlord, Omen, Helstar, Candlemass, and Iron Maiden. The band established its personal style with songs like “Stormbringer (The Black Sword)” and “Army of The Dead”, and power metal assaults like “The Mass Of Chaos” and “The Midnight Meat Train”. Some of the songs have progressive structures like the title track, “The Eternal Champion”, a 12 minutes long suite divided in seven parts.
In 1998, keyboards player Riccardo Iacono entered the band and singer Morby sang in Labyrinth during their European tour with HammerFall.
